Thorps in a changing landscape /

Considering the minor settlements of England's Danelaw, villages known as thorps or throps, this history demonstrates how place-name evidence can be used to understand early cultures. By integrating linguistic and archaeological approaches, it establishes a compelling connection between the cre...
